General statistics
List of Youtube channels
Youtube commenter search
Distinguished comments
About
youyoutobio
Dashcam Lessons
comments
Comments by "youyoutobio" (@youyoutobio) on "Dashcam Lessons" channel.
I thought russians were the worst drivers on the planet but looks like the americans are starting to gain the advantage
1